Iâve had a lot of stereo equipment over the years and size maters. If you want room shaking bass you must have large bass speakers in well designed cabinets. Resonates must be flat with little peaks or valleys.Some small âboom boxesâ get the âthumpâ by peaking resonance thatâs not actually related to the real frequency of the music. Itâs a trick to make you believe itâs actually a real musical note. The lower the frequency, the worse it becomes.That said, some small devices like this one, give you enough low end without distortion. Not deep bass because it is impossible with 4 inch speakers. But it is accurate to the mid lows so you get a better sense of the music.This unit has a line input and Bluetooth so you can connect accessories. The CD player is functional and easy to use. The FM is a bit clunky to program but delivers good sound. The remote does the job.Overall, this is a very nice unit that pulls above its weight and the price is very reasonable. It looks good too.

This unit was purchased to take the place of a Bose Wave System IV I purchased 3 years ago that never lived up to its name or the Bose reputation. The Lonpoo 816 is a very stylish, solid looking unit. The remote control aside from it being shipped without the 2 AAA batteries worked flawlessly and was easy to use. The sound quality of the surround sound put my Bose to shame, and I liked being able to adjust the sound quality to the type of music being played. CD drive worked well, and playback quality of my recorded CDâs was excellent. It paired with my Bluetooth perfectly and I was able to stream all my Apple Music as well as Sirius XM channels without any problems. Set up very easy. The best part, I payed 5 times less for this unit than my Bose when it was purchased.

OMG!!! How awful!!! How can this have so many good reviews? The worst thing is that every time you turn the power on, the volume blares out at Vol 16. Getting the sound back to normal listening volume takes a little while. I scare family members in other rooms every time I put the radio on. When using Bluetooth, there is a hiss or crackling sound unless you listen to loud rock. The EQ is worthless. The sound is generally muffled. I will use it as a CD player for now. I use the radio in my small wood shop and it sounds pretty darn good with a good bass sound. One thing that I don’t like is that when I turn it on the volume goes automatically to “15” and then I have to turn it down to about 4. I wish it had memory to where it would remember my last settings and go there automatically. I tried the Bluetooth with my Echo Dot and the distance is about 20 feet and then I lose reception so I don’t use Bluetooth because I need about 35 feet.
